Embedded Linux Development Using Yocto Projects - Third Edition: Wykorzystaj moc projektu Yocto do tworzenia wydajnych produktów opartych na systemie Linux

Ocena:   (4,6 na 5)

Embedded Linux Development Using Yocto Projects - Third Edition: Wykorzystaj moc projektu Yocto do tworzenia wydajnych produktów opartych na systemie Linux (Otavio Salvador)

Opinie czytelników

Podsumowanie:

Książka jest kompleksowym przewodnikiem po projekcie Yocto, skierowanym zarówno do początkujących, jak i doświadczonych programistów. Zapewnia dogłębną wiedzę na temat BitBake, niestandardowych przepisów i praktycznych porad dotyczących poruszania się po środowisku Yocto, dzięki czemu jest cennym podręcznikiem dla każdego zaangażowanego w rozwój wbudowanego systemu Linux.

Zalety:

Bardzo szczegółowa i dokładna, obejmuje wszystko, od podstawowych po zaawansowane techniki, praktyczne przykłady, praktyczną naukę, przydatną zarówno dla początkujących, jak i doświadczonych programistów, świetne źródło informacji na temat rozwiązywania typowych problemów, doskonały układ i typografię ułatwiającą zrozumienie, a także zawiera kluczowe najlepsze praktyki zarządzania projektami.

Wady:

Książka może być przytłaczająca dla niektórych czytelników ze względu na poziom szczegółowości, a niektóre tematy, takie jak tymczasowy katalog kompilacji, mogą być mylące dla początkujących. Wymaga proaktywnego podejścia ze strony czytelników, aby w pełni skorzystać z treści.

(na podstawie 7 opinii czytelników)

Oryginalny tytuł:

Embedded Linux Development Using Yocto Projects - Third Edition: Leverage the power of the Yocto Project to build efficient Linux-based products

Zawartość książki:

Ulepsz swój system oparty na Linuksie dzięki projektom Yocto, zwiększając jego stabilność i odporność w wydajny i ekonomiczny sposób - teraz zaktualizowany do najnowszej wersji Yocto Project.

Zakup książki w wersji drukowanej lub Kindle obejmuje bezpłatny eBook w formacie PDF

Kluczowe cechy:

⬤ Optymalizuj swoje narzędzia Yocto Project, aby tworzyć wydajne projekty oparte na systemie Linux.

⬤ Podążaj za praktycznym podejściem do nauki rozwoju Linuksa przy użyciu Yocto Project.

⬤ Wykorzystaj najlepsze praktyki dla wbudowanego systemu Linux i rozwoju Yocto Project.

Opis książki:

Yocto Project to branżowy standard tworzenia niezawodnych projektów wbudowanych w system Linux. Wyróżnia się na tle innych frameworków, oferując efektywny czasowo rozwój przy zwiększonej niezawodności i solidności.

Dzięki Embedded Linux Development Using Yocto Project zdobędziesz wiedzę na temat narzędzi Yocto Project, pomagających w wykonywaniu różnych zadań opartych na systemie Linux. Zyskasz dogłębne zrozumienie Poky i BitBake, poznasz praktyczne przypadki użycia do tworzenia projektu podsystemu Linux, wykorzystasz narzędzia Yocto Project dostępne dla wbudowanego systemu Linux i odkryjesz sekrety SDK, narzędzia receptur i innych. To nowe wydanie jest dostosowane do najnowszej wersji długoterminowego wsparcia wyżej wymienionych technologii i wprowadza dwa nowe rozdziały, obejmujące optymalną emulację w QEMU w celu szybszego rozwoju produktu i najlepszych praktyk.

Pod koniec tej książki będziesz dobrze przygotowany do generowania i uruchamiania obrazów prawdziwych płyt sprzętowych. Zdobędziesz praktyczne doświadczenie w budowaniu wydajnych systemów Linux przy użyciu projektu Yocto.

Czego się nauczysz:

⬤ Poznaj przepływy pracy Poky.

⬤ Skonfigurować i przygotować środowisko kompilacji Poky.

⬤ Zapoznać się z najnowszą wersją Yocto Project na przykładach.

⬤ Konfiguracja serwera kompilacji i dostosowywanie obrazów przy użyciu Toastera.

⬤ Generowanie obrazów i dopasowywanie pakietów do utworzonych obrazów przy użyciu BitBake.

⬤ Wspieranie procesu rozwoju poprzez konfigurowanie i używanie kanałów pakietów.

⬤ Debugowanie projektu Yocto poprzez konfigurację Poky.

⬤ Budowanie i uruchamianie obrazu dla BeagleBone Black, RaspberryPi 4 i VisionFive za pośrednictwem kart SD.

⬤ Zapoznanie się z wykorzystaniem QEMU w celu przyspieszenia cyklu rozwoju przy użyciu emulacji.

Dla kogo jest ta książka:

Jeśli jesteś programistą wbudowanego systemu Linux i chcesz poszerzyć swoją wiedzę na temat projektu Yocto o przykłady rozwoju wbudowanego, to ta książka jest dla Ciebie. Profesjonaliści poszukujący nowego spojrzenia na metodologie pracy nad rozwojem Linuksa również znajdą w tej książce wiele pomocnych informacji.

Dodatkowe informacje o książce:

ISBN:9781804615065
Autor:
Wydawca:
Język:angielski
Oprawa:Miękka oprawa

Zakup:

Obecnie dostępne, na stanie.

Inne książki autora:

Embedded Linux Development z Yocto Project: Rozwijaj fascynujące projekty oparte na systemie Linux...
Rozwijaj fascynujące projekty oparte na systemie...
Embedded Linux Development z Yocto Project: Rozwijaj fascynujące projekty oparte na systemie Linux przy użyciu przełomowych narzędzi Yocto Project. - Embedded Linux Development with Yocto Project: Develop fascinating Linux-based projects using the groundbreaking Yocto Project tools
Embedded Linux Development Using Yocto Projects - Third Edition: Wykorzystaj moc projektu Yocto do...
Ulepsz swój system oparty na Linuksie dzięki...
Embedded Linux Development Using Yocto Projects - Third Edition: Wykorzystaj moc projektu Yocto do tworzenia wydajnych produktów opartych na systemie Linux - Embedded Linux Development Using Yocto Projects - Third Edition: Leverage the power of the Yocto Project to build efficient Linux-based products
Embedded Linux Development using Yocto Projects - Second Edition: Naucz się wykorzystywać moc Yocto...
Zoptymalizuj i usprawnij swój system oparty na...
Embedded Linux Development using Yocto Projects - Second Edition: Naucz się wykorzystywać moc Yocto Project do tworzenia wydajnych produktów opartych na systemie Linux - Embedded Linux Development using Yocto Projects - Second Edition: Learn to leverage the power of Yocto Project to build efficient Linux-based products

Prace autora wydały następujące wydawnictwa: